Mi Sol Montessori Academy

Mi Sol Montessori Preschool's aim is to aid the child in the process of their self-construction.
Mi Sol Montessori is determined to provide children of diverse races and diverse backgrounds with a superior holistic early childhood learning experience and environment.
We are convinced that the montessori method is a superior teaching method.
When used in conjunction with a spanish language immersion program, our families' expectations for their child will be exceeded.
The organization appreciates and values the opportunity it has to make a difference in children's lives.
As such, we take nothing for granted and aspire to achieve great things in early childhood education.

Quick Facts (2025-26)

  • School Type: Montessori School
  • Grades: Prekindergarten-6
  • Enrollment: 36 students
  • Application Deadline: None / Rolling
